Overview

LLP2A-alendronate is a bone-targeted peptidomimetic conjugate designed to promote bone formation and repair by recruiting mesenchymal stem cells (MSCs) directly to the bone surface. The molecule consists of two functional moieties: **alendronate**, a bisphosphonate that provides high affinity for the bone mineral hydroxyapatite, and **LLP2A**, a high-affinity peptidomimetic ligand that specifically targets the active conformation of **integrin alpha-4 beta-1** (VLA-4) expressed on MSCs. By anchoring to the bone surface via the alendronate component, the conjugate creates a localized concentration of LLP2A that acts as a "homing beacon" for circulating or resident MSCs. Once recruited, these stem cells differentiate into osteoblasts, thereby increasing bone mass and strength. This approach is being investigated as an anabolic (bone-building) therapy for conditions characterized by bone loss or poor healing, such as osteoporosis and osteonecrosis.
